Scope of the Journal
The Journal of Pericardiology focuses on scientific and clinical research related to pericardial diseases and cardiovascular medicine. The journal encourages submissions that contribute to improved diagnosis, treatment strategies, and long-term management of pericardial disorders.
- Acute and Chronic Pericarditis
- Pericardial Effusion and Cardiac Tamponade
- Constrictive Pericarditis
- Diagnostic Imaging of the Pericardium
- Surgical and Interventional Management
- Infectious and Systemic Diseases Affecting the Pericardium
- Innovative Therapies and Clinical Case Studies
